Nanocrystalline magnesium - nanoMag LLC, a subsidiary of Thixomat Inc.

July 31, 2010
The material is tougher than standard magnesium and twice as strong.

nanoMAG magnesium sheet has a yield strength of 250 MPa -- over twice as strong as conventional magnesium -- and 10% elongation due to isotropic fine-grained strengthening. The material's strength matches that of carbon steel sheet at 75% lower weight.
Secondary thermo-mechanical processing of a Thixomolded sheet/plate results in ultra-fine-grain magnesium sheet. The metal is produced in nanoMAG’s “mini-mill” operation, discrete manufacturing cells capable of producing 500 tons/yr.
